Strange, I have both 450i and 450m running gigabit with no errors.  Using 
“Cambium sync” though.

 

So basically you’re saying the GDT version is better for data integrity?  And 
only for Cambium radios?

 

What about surge protection, it looks like it clamps all 8 wires at 90V to 
ground, but doesn’t try to clamp the differential voltage at some lower voltage 
like the other version?  I’m not sure how much of a problem that might be.

It doesn’t mess up Cambium.  Cambium can have frame check and crc errors with 
nothing more than plain cable.  Adding solid state surge suppressors causes 
problems for some reasons.  100% gas discharge tube cures that.
